<pPlumbing services in Cape Town emphasise safety and reliability. Repairs address leaks, dripping taps, running toilets, clogged drains, hot water systems, and issues with water pressure. The approach typically involves leak detection, pipe tracing, pressure testing, and targeted repairs or replacements of components such as valves, connectors, and seals. Emphasis is placed on preventing future problems through proper sealing practices, appropriate pipe sizing, and the use of high-quality fittings. <pAir conditioner repairs focus on restoring cooling performance, managing refrigerant integrity, and ensuring safe operation. Technicians commonly perform system checks, thermostat calibration, condensate drainage cleaning, coil inspection, and compressor evaluation. If refrigerant handling is required, licensed practises and compliance with applicable regulations become essential considerations. <pRefrigerator repairs focus on temperature regulation, defrost system efficiency, and door alignment. Common concerns include frost build-up, ice maker malfunctions, and fan noise. Practitioners typically verify thermostat readings, inspect condensers and evaporators, and confirm airflow pathways. Preventive maintenance guidance—such as regular cleaning of coils and maintaining appropriate door seals—helps prolong life and reduce the likelihood of repeated breakdowns.
